Output 633210168bf96694de230a5396ba1b188238bb76ad6b66ad71223aaedb53fabf:27

value
1151056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2380f4e34581e142224a1af0b4737fec11b063a0 OP_EQUAL
address
34vk4KTH5KzTFMv1sN3VYnyjSf2wBucWZR
transaction
633210168bf96694de230a5396ba1b188238bb76ad6b66ad71223aaedb53fabf
spent
false